Liquid Chromatograph-Mass Spectrometry-Based Non-targeted Metabolomics Discovery of Potential Endogenous Biomarkers Associated With Prostatitis Rats to Reveal the Effects of Magnoflorine

Abstract: Magnoflorine (Mag) has multiple pharmacological activities for the prevention and treatment of prostatitis. However, its molecular mechanisms andpharmacological targets are not clear. In this study, the ultra-performance liquid tandem mass spectrometry-based metabolomics method was used to clarify the intervention of Mag against prostatitis and the biological mechanism. A total of 25 biomarkers associated with the prostatitis model were identified by metabolomics, and a number of metabolic pathways closely rel… Show more

“…First, the two complementary strategies, non-targeted metabolomics and metabolite target analysis were used. Non-targeted metabolomics is a valuable approach to obtaining a comprehensive depiction of the metabolic status closely related to the phenotypic outcome of interest in an unbiased manner [ 38 ]. Meanwhile, targeted metabolomics, which is an accurate quantitative method to analyze biochemically known and annotated metabolites, provides information that is more precise on specific metabolites and metabolic pathways [ 39 ].…”
